Abstract
The synthesis, structure and properties of the new microporous zinc phosphonate [Zn-2(H2PPB)(H2O)2]center dot xH(2)O (denoted as CAU-25, CAU stands for Christian-Albrechts-University) are presented. The crystal structure was determined by combining single crystal and powder X-ray diffraction data. The final refinement was carried out by using the Rietveld method. The structure contains one-dimensional channels between dense, corrugated, hydrogen bonded layers with a diameter of approximately 5 angstrom. While N-2 uptake was not observed at 77 K, CO2 and H2O uptakes were measured at 298 K.
